Summary: Treatment research study for advanced non-small cell lung cancer

Non-small cell lung cancer that has spread to other parts of the body (known as metastasis) is often treated with a combination of chemotherapy drugs. The purpose of this study is to evaluate a drug that is not a traditional chemotherapy drug, but rather is meant to enhance the effectiveness of other standard chemotherapy treatments. This study will evaluate whether this investigational drug can improve the effectiveness of a chemotherapy regimen consisting of cisplatin and vinorelbine, a commonly used combination for advanced non-small cell lung cancer.

A physician participating in the study will determine eligibility, but if you meet the following criteria, you may qualify for this study:

  • Stage IIIb or Stage IV.NSCLC (advanced disease)
  • No evidence of brain metastasis
  • No prior chemotherapy for advanced disease
  • No treatment with any investigational drug or radiation within 30 days prior to beginning treatment with study drug
  • Must be inoperable disease (not curable with surgery)
